首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Python中将Json转换为Excel或CSV

在Python中,可以使用第三方库pandas来将JSON转换为Excel或CSV格式的文件。

首先,需要安装pandas库。可以使用以下命令来安装:

代码语言:txt
复制
pip install pandas

接下来,可以使用以下代码将JSON数据转换为Excel文件:

代码语言:txt
复制
import pandas as pd
import json

# 读取JSON数据
with open('data.json') as f:
    data = json.load(f)

# 转换为DataFrame
df = pd.DataFrame(data)

# 保存为Excel文件
df.to_excel('data.xlsx', index=False)

上述代码中,首先使用json.load()函数读取JSON文件中的数据,并存储在变量data中。然后,使用pd.DataFrame()函数将数据转换为DataFrame对象。最后,使用df.to_excel()方法将DataFrame保存为Excel文件,其中index=False表示不保存行索引。

如果要将JSON数据转换为CSV文件,可以使用以下代码:

代码语言:txt
复制
import pandas as pd
import json

# 读取JSON数据
with open('data.json') as f:
    data = json.load(f)

# 转换为DataFrame
df = pd.DataFrame(data)

# 保存为CSV文件
df.to_csv('data.csv', index=False)

上述代码与前面的代码类似,只是使用了df.to_csv()方法将DataFrame保存为CSV文件。

推荐的腾讯云相关产品:无

希望以上信息能对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券